The frictional resistance between the road and the car's … WebApr 9, 2002 · A car's crumple zones do the real work of softening the blow. Crumple zones are areas in the front and rear of a car that collapse relatively easily. Instead of the entire car coming to an abrupt stop when it hits an obstacle, it absorbs some of the impact force by flattening, like an empty soda can. WebTo stop such an object, it is necessary to apply a force against its motion for a given period of time. The more momentum that an object has, the harder that it is to stop. WebDec 29, 2024 · At first, the driver sits in the car in constant motion with speed v v. Then, a car hits the tree and immediately stops. The driver flies forward due to the inertial force until suddenly stopped by the impact on the steering column or windshield.
